So I finally got back into my friends 1790’s farm for some hunting.
Started out super slow just digging trash, then got a great signal from under an old clothes line. About 4” down and out popped an 1943S walking liberty half (first half found).
After that found a few wheats (1920 and 1918) in rough shape. Moving on.
Out around an old tree stump I dung my first Rosie, a 1947.… then more trash.
Moved out about 100 yards away from the house near and old fence line and got a screaming 34 on the nox showing Max depth. Dug and dug, then dug some more.
Out comes my first large cent, an 1824. Continued on my path and then got another signal
this time around 27-29. I was thinking silver dime, but nope… and 1834 Lc.
Now comes the one I need help with. I believe it’s an old cigarette case. The two LC’s
and this we’re all found within 8ft of each other. Didn’t clean it, just washed the dirt off with a toothbrush. Dont know if it’s silver and is 3” x 4” And has what I think is a Japanese hallmark on the inside of the back of the case.
An anyone identify this hallmark, curious about age and whether or not it’s silver.
